BBC Radio dramatizes Dickens's famous melodrama about orphan Pip, who rises from poverty to sudden great fortune. Not only is the acting high quality, but the voices seem matched to their parts with special care and intelligence. Cuts in the story are hardly noticeable, except for occasional abrupt scenes in which plot points must be made willy-nilly. Another weakness is the music: generic (it seems familiar from other BBC programs), repetitive, at times inappropriate to the action, but, like most wallpaper, easily ignored. All in all, a fine rendering of Pip's story--but the names of the cast that makes it fine should have been listed. W.M. © AudioFile 2006, Portland, Maine [Published: DEC 06/ JAN 07]
